Why Homeowners Skip Dryer Vent Cleaning?


Cleaning a dryer vent doesn’t sound urgent right?
After all, the dryer still turns on, still spins, and still seems to do its job... until it doesn’t.

Most homeowners assume:

  • “It’s just lint — how bad can it be?”

  • “I clean the lint trap after every load, so the vent should be fine.”

  • “It’s only a problem for older dryers.”

But here’s the truth: the lint trap only catches about 25% of the lint your dryer produces.
The rest gets sucked into the vent, where it builds up over time slowly choking the system and creating a real fire hazard.
